Tsitsikamma.

Standing guard over the treetop canopy in the heart of the forest isThe Big Tree – an eight hundred- year-old Yellowwood. This majestic tree towers over the rest of the canopy; standing 36+m (119ft) tall and with a trunk circumference of 9m (30ft) – this is a giant among giants.
